The first round games and byes are determined by a random draw of all teams in the division. Depending on the number of league games in the division, the first round games may also be league games (marked on schedule). In these cases, the score used in league standings will be the score prior to any overtime. Only teams awarded a win in the first round will advance to the next round. Games in all rounds are determined by a random draw of teams remaining. If two teams are tied in any game, over time procedure is two 5 minute halves with the first goal scored determining the winner. If still tied at the end of overtime, game will advance to a shoot out. In the Youth League, the League Champion is considered the “City Champion”. The RSA Cup gives each team the opportunity to compete for the “RSA Cup Champion” title!!
Remember: Guest Players are not eligible to play in the RSA Cup!!!!
